6/4/2023 0 Comments Vmc mastercam program![]() ![]() Examples of these programs are Mastercam (). Once we have used the M-Code M99 to return to the main program we would use M30 to tell the machine that the program has finished and to stop the machine. FULL-SIZE VMC CNC MACHINES Haas Automation (Oxnard, CA), Fadal (Chatsworth, CA. In addition, CIMCO Edit includes file compare, mill/turn backplotter, advanced Tool Manager, NC code assistant and offers powerful add-ons for machine simulation. ![]() ![]() We can not jump back to the main program without returning to the program that called the subprogram. CIMCO Edit comes with all the essential features needed for modern NC program editing including NC specific functions, math, transforms, drag/drop editing and more. G83 deep hole drilling cycle ka use kese karte h in vmc machine. M99 will always return to the program that it came from, even if it is a subprogram. The program must adhere to this format for the Fanuc to take it into internal memory. The M-Code M99 will tell the machine that the subprogram that it is currently running has come to an end, if the subprogram has run the number of times specified by the initial program call using M98 P_ It will stop running the subprogram and return from to the previous program and continue to run from the line below the M98 line. Up to 4 subprograms can be nested, this means we can call upon a subprogram inside another subprogram up to 4 times ![]() Note: the previous program may be a subprogram. The number that precedes the program number is the amount of times it is to be repeated (in this case 5 times)Īt the end of the subprogram, the M-Code M99 is used to return to the previous program. On a VMC with ATC, usually the T word tells the mill to select that tool, but it requires the M06 word to be executed before the tool is actually changed.The M98 command is used to call a subprogram followed by the program number and the amount of times that we wish to repeat running that subprogram. This saves time by running a task that is often repeated by storing it in memory. I do it that way because I want my MC Axes to match my Machine Axes, even though its perfectly fine to use the Front, Side, etc. We can call upon subprograms within our main CNC program to run tasks. I program Horizontls the same wasy I program Verticals and let the post handle axis swaps. ![]()
0 Comments
Leave a Reply. |